在软件开发的过程中,Git成为了最流行的版本控制系统之一。而git的工作流程对于多人协同开发来说至关重要。在这篇文章中,我将介绍一种快速协同开发的Git工作流,帮助团队成员高效地协同开发。
概述
这种Git工作流主要包括两个分支:主分支(master)和开发分支(develop)。主分支用于发布稳定版本,而开发分支用于开发新功能和修复bug。
步骤
以下是实现快速协同开发的Git工作流的具体步骤:
-
创建主分支(master):这个分支应该是稳定版本的代码,只有在经过测试并准备发布时才能将代码合并到主分支。
-
开发分支(develop):这是开发新功能和修复bug的主要分支。所有团队成员都应从此分支开始新的工作。
-
功能分支:当一个新功能需要开发时,应从开发分支(develop)创建一个新的功能分支。这样每个团队成员都可以在自己的分支上独立工作,避免互相干扰。
-
提交代码:在每个功能分支上开发完毕后,团队成员应提交代码到远程仓库。此时,可以通过pull request来进行代码评审,并在合并前进行必要的修改。
-
合并代码:当一个功能被审查并获得批准后,可以将代码合并到开发分支(develop)。这样其他团队成员就可以看到最新的代码,并将其合并到自己的功能分支中。
-
发布版本:当开发分支上的代码经过测试并被认为稳定时,可以将其合并到主分支(master),并发布一个新的版本。
-
解决冲突:在合并代码的过程中,可能会遇到冲突。这时需要通过协作来解决冲突,以确保代码的稳定性。
结论
通过使用这种快速协同开发的Git工作流,团队成员可以高效地协同开发新功能和修复bug。每个人都可以在自己的分支上进行工作,避免互相干扰,并通过合并和发布版本来保持代码的稳定性。Git工作流的灵活性和强大性使其成为多人协同开发的首选工具。
希望这篇文章对于正在寻找快速协同开发的Git工作流的人们有所帮助。如果你有任何问题或建议,请在下面的评论中告诉我。感谢阅读!
本文来自极简博客,作者:软件测试视界,转载请注明原文链接:如何实现快速协同开发的Git工作流